A tax receipt will be emailed to each donor by The Giving Block. In the United States the receipt can be used for tax-deductible purposes. Other countries have different rules regarding Crypto donations and we suggest overseas supporters check with a local advisor to see if you can claim the value of your donation on your taxes.
Generally, giving Cryptocurrency is a non-taxable event. Donors do not owe capital gains tax on the appreciated crypto that is donated and can typically deduct the fair market value of the donation on their taxes.
